Al Aber
Albert Julius Aber (Lefty)
Bats: Left , Throws: Left
Height: 6' 2" , Weight: 195 lb.

Born: July 31, 1927 in Cleveland, OH
High School: West Technical (Cleveland, OH)
Signed
by the Cleveland Indians as an amateur free agent in 1946. (All Transactions)
Debut: September 15, 1950
Final Game: September 11, 1957
Died: May 20, 1993 in Garfield Heights, OH
